- The distance between Charlotte/ Douglas, Nc, Usa and Aberdeen, Scotland, Uk is approximately 6,135 km or 3,812 mi.
- To reach Charlotte/ Douglas, Nc in this distance one would set out from Aberdeen, Scotland bearing 282.6° or WNW and follow the great circles arc to approach Charlotte/ Douglas, Nc bearing 220.4° or SW .
- Charlotte/ Douglas, Nc has a humid subtropical climate (Cfa) whereas Aberdeen, Scotland has a marine west coast climate (Cfb).
- Charlotte/ Douglas, Nc is in or near the warm temperate moist forest biome whereas Aberdeen, Scotland is in or near the cool temperate moist forest biome.
- The mean annual temperature is 7.8 °C (14°F) warmer.
- Average monthly temperatures vary by 11.1 °C (20°F) more in Charlotte/ Douglas, Nc. The continentality subtype is subcontinental as opposed to truly oceanic.
- Total annual precipitation averages 310.3 mm (12.2 in) more which is equivalent to 310.3 l/m² (7.62 US gal/ft²) or 3,103,000 l/ha (331,731 US gal/ac) more. About 1 2/5 as much.
- The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 21.9° higher in Charlotte/ Douglas, Nc than in Aberdeen, Scotland.
